Transaction f52f9a34c3f48418963bf710c16cd66468657fc2894c432049e3cfd3145ac8cd

21 Input
2 Outputs
  • f52f9a34c3f48418963bf710c16cd66468657fc2894c432049e3cfd3145ac8cd:0
  • value  12000000
    address  38eMrpGs7dyMUEbDKespRTUyBdM3Lp7KDS
  • f52f9a34c3f48418963bf710c16cd66468657fc2894c432049e3cfd3145ac8cd:1
  • value  50634
    address  3B4J788HK8pR41dm9MEt22e4J7L1SsrzE4